Bladen Hall fire leaves nine homeless

The destroyed house

A devastating fire, which the Guyana Fire Service [GFS] said originated from a slack connection, yesterday morning completely destroyed a one-flat wooden house at Lot 111 Bladen Hall, Railway Embankment, East Coast of Demerara.

As a result nine persons, including three minors, were left homeless. The home was owned by 48-year-old Aubrie Matthew.

Stabroek News spoke to Joshua Fletchman, a prison officer and son of Matthew, who said that at around 7:40 am yesterday  he received a call from his relatives that their home was on fire. Fletchman said though neither he nor his parents were at home at the time. His two sisters along with three minors were there. What he learnt was that it was a 10-year-old who notified everyone in the home that smoke was coming from the back bedroom which then turned into a fire. Everyone in the home at the time, Fletchman said, rushed out to escape the blaze. He told  Stabroek News that none of the adults could say what actually caused the fire.
